00021 #include <strings.h>
00022 #include "avformat.h"
00023 #include "metadata.h"
00024 #include "libavutil/avstring.h"
00025
00026 #if LIBAVFORMAT_VERSION_MAJOR < 53
00027
00028 #define SIZE_OFFSET(x) sizeof(((AVFormatContext*)0)->x),offsetof(AVFormatContext,x)
00029
00030 static const struct {
00031 const char name[16];
00032 int size;
00033 int offset;
00034 } compat_tab[] = {
00035 { "title", SIZE_OFFSET(title) },
00036 { "author", SIZE_OFFSET(author) },
00037 { "copyright", SIZE_OFFSET(copyright) },
00038 { "comment", SIZE_OFFSET(comment) },
00039 { "album", SIZE_OFFSET(album) },
00040 { "year", SIZE_OFFSET(year) },
00041 { "track", SIZE_OFFSET(track) },
00042 { "genre", SIZE_OFFSET(genre) },
00043
00044 { "artist", SIZE_OFFSET(author) },
00045 { "creator", SIZE_OFFSET(author) },
00046 { "written_by", SIZE_OFFSET(author) },
00047 { "lead_performer", SIZE_OFFSET(author) },
00048 { "description", SIZE_OFFSET(comment) },
00049 { "albumtitle", SIZE_OFFSET(album) },
00050 { "date_written", SIZE_OFFSET(year) },
00051 { "date_released", SIZE_OFFSET(year) },
00052 { "tracknumber", SIZE_OFFSET(track) },
00053 { "part_number", SIZE_OFFSET(track) },
00054 };
00055
00056 void ff_metadata_demux_compat(AVFormatContext *ctx)
00057 {
00058 AVMetadata *m;
00059 int i, j;
00060
00061 if ((m = ctx->metadata))
00062 for (j=0; j<m->count; j++)
00063 for (i=0; i<FF_ARRAY_ELEMS(compat_tab); i++)
00064 if (!strcasecmp(m->elems[j].key, compat_tab[i].name)) {
00065 int *ptr = (int *)((char *)ctx+compat_tab[i].offset);
00066 if (*ptr) continue;
00067 if (compat_tab[i].size > sizeof(int))
00068 av_strlcpy((char *)ptr, m->elems[j].value, compat_tab[i].size);
00069 else
00070 *ptr = atoi(m->elems[j].value);
00071 }
00072
00073 for (i=0; i<ctx->nb_chapters; i++)
00074 if ((m = ctx->chapters[i]->metadata))
00075 for (j=0; j<m->count; j++)
00076 if (!strcasecmp(m->elems[j].key, "title")) {
00077 av_free(ctx->chapters[i]->title);
00078 ctx->chapters[i]->title = av_strdup(m->elems[j].value);
00079 }
00080
00081 for (i=0; i<ctx->nb_programs; i++)
00082 if ((m = ctx->programs[i]->metadata))
00083 for (j=0; j<m->count; j++) {
00084 if (!strcasecmp(m->elems[j].key, "name")) {
00085 av_free(ctx->programs[i]->name);
00086 ctx->programs[i]->name = av_strdup(m->elems[j].value);
00087 }
00088 if (!strcasecmp(m->elems[j].key, "provider_name")) {
00089 av_free(ctx->programs[i]->provider_name);
00090 ctx->programs[i]->provider_name = av_strdup(m->elems[j].value);
00091 }
00092 }
00093
00094 for (i=0; i<ctx->nb_streams; i++)
00095 if ((m = ctx->streams[i]->metadata))
00096 for (j=0; j<m->count; j++) {
00097 if (!strcasecmp(m->elems[j].key, "language"))
00098 av_strlcpy(ctx->streams[i]->language, m->elems[j].value, 4);
00099 if (!strcasecmp(m->elems[j].key, "filename")) {
00100 av_free(ctx->streams[i]->filename);
00101 ctx->streams[i]->filename= av_strdup(m->elems[j].value);
00102 }
00103 }
00104 }
00105
00106
00107 #define FILL_METADATA(s, key, value) { \
00108 if (value && *value && !av_metadata_get(s->metadata, #key, NULL, 0)) \
00109 av_metadata_set(&s->metadata, #key, value); \
00110 }
00111 #define FILL_METADATA_STR(s, key) FILL_METADATA(s, key, s->key)
00112 #define FILL_METADATA_INT(s, key) { \
00113 char number[10]; \
00114 snprintf(number, sizeof(number), "%d", s->key); \
00115 if(s->key) FILL_METADATA(s, key, number) }
00116
00117 void ff_metadata_mux_compat(AVFormatContext *ctx)
00118 {
00119 int i;
00120
00121 if (ctx->metadata && ctx->metadata->count > 0)
00122 return;
00123
00124 FILL_METADATA_STR(ctx, title);
00125 FILL_METADATA_STR(ctx, author);
00126 FILL_METADATA_STR(ctx, copyright);
00127 FILL_METADATA_STR(ctx, comment);
00128 FILL_METADATA_STR(ctx, album);
00129 FILL_METADATA_INT(ctx, year);
00130 FILL_METADATA_INT(ctx, track);
00131 FILL_METADATA_STR(ctx, genre);
00132 for (i=0; i<ctx->nb_chapters; i++)
00133 FILL_METADATA_STR(ctx->chapters[i], title);
00134 for (i=0; i<ctx->nb_programs; i++) {
00135 FILL_METADATA_STR(ctx->programs[i], name);
00136 FILL_METADATA_STR(ctx->programs[i], provider_name);
00137 }
00138 for (i=0; i<ctx->nb_streams; i++) {
00139 FILL_METADATA_STR(ctx->streams[i], language);
00140 FILL_METADATA_STR(ctx->streams[i], filename);
00141 }
00142 }
00143
00144 #endif
